Full boost at what rpm ZC with a T-25
 
I have a dohc ZC with a t-25 almost done . I was wondering when (what rpm ) it starts to make boost and when it will make full boost .
I have HF mani , adaptor plate and t-25 , tyrus's intercooler .and 2.5 inch IC pipes

this seems to be a common setup if anyone is running this setup or has first hand info on it please pass it along

theebluecrx 04-08-2004 08:14 PM

Re:Full boost at what rpm ZC with a T-25
 
My t25 spooled at about 2500 with a fully ported hf manifold and plate setup.It died and the 13g(1g dsm auto) i replaced it with had the same spool but more top end.
